Description
Centered on the anterior abdominal wall, the paired rectus abdominis muscles run vertically from the pubic crest and pubic symphysis inferiorly to the xiphoid process and costal cartilages of ribs 5 to 7 superiorly. Transverse tendinous intersections segment each muscle belly, lying superficial to the anterior layer of the rectus sheath and separated at the midline by the linea alba. Laterally, the rectus borders approach the semilunar lines where the aponeuroses of external oblique, internal oblique, and transversus abdominis contribute to the sheath. Skeletal landmarks frame the field. This anterior presentation matters because it ties muscle form to the surgical and clinical map of the abdomen: the linea alba is a standard midline entry for laparotomy, while the rectus sheath and its arcuate line govern tissue layers you encounter when placing trocars or closing fascia. Contraction patterns across the tendinous intersections help explain why partial tears and hematomas may localize to a segment, and why rectus sheath hematoma can mimic acute intraabdominal pain, often after anticoagulation or vigorous coughing. Clear midline and lateral borders also support teaching diastasis recti, where the rectus bellies drift laterally as the linea alba widens.
